ALEXANDRIA, Va., Sept. 10 -- United States Patent no. 12,413,650, issued on Sept. 9, was assigned to Cisco Technology Inc. (San Jose, Calif.).
"Routing application control and data-plane traffic in support of cloud-native applications" was invented by Vincent Parla (North Hampton, N.H.) and Kyle Andrew Donald Mestery (Woodbury, Minn.).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"Techniques for using computer networking protocol extensions to route control-plane traffic and data-plane traffic associated with a common application are described herein.
